[0day-rubbish] Royal Server 5.04.50529.0 Local privilege escalation to LocalSystem on the execution path without credential override (7.2)

0day Rubbish Research Team disclosed a CVSS 7.2 local privilege escalation (CWE-250) in Royal Server 5.04.50529.0 to LocalSystem.

Researchers publicly disclosed a local privilege escalation vulnerability in Royal Server 5.04.50529.0, classified as CWE-250 (execution with unnecessary privileges) with a CVSS score of 7.2. The flaw allows escalation to LocalSystem on the execution path without credential override. The disclosure was posted to the Full Disclosure mailing list on September 8, 2026; no patch or CVE id was mentioned in the notice.

[0day-rubbish] Jitterbit Agent 12.8.1.6 (Docker jitterbit/agent:12.8.1.6) Unauthenticated SOAP with hard-coded credentials leading to OS command execution (9.8)

Jitterbit Agent 12.8.1.6's Docker image exposes unauthenticated SOAP with hard-coded credentials, leading to OS command execution (CVSS 9.8).

0day Rubbish Research Team disclosed that the jitterbit/agent:12.8.1.6 Docker image ships an unauthenticated SOAP interface protected by hard-coded credentials. Attackers who recover these credentials can invoke the SOAP endpoint to execute OS commands, with the issue rated CVSS 9.8. The disclosure does not mention a CVE identifier or observed exploitation in the wild.

[0day-rubbish] Accurate Online Private Cloud on-prem (current) Unauthenticated Hessian deserialization leading to JNDI remote class loading (9.8)

0day Rubbish disclosed an unauthenticated Hessian deserialization flaw in Accurate Online Private Cloud on-prem allowing JNDI remote class loading, rated 9.8.

The 0day Rubbish Research Team publicly disclosed an unauthenticated Hessian deserialization vulnerability in the current on-premises release of Accurate Online Private Cloud. The flaw lets unauthenticated attackers trigger JNDI remote class loading, a path that typically yields remote code execution. The issue carries a CVSS 9.8 rating. No CVE identifier or evidence of in-the-wild exploitation was included in the disclosure.

**Subject:** CVE-2026-2035703: Tozed ZLT X300 5G CPE — Unauthenticated Remote Root Code Execution via TR-069 Command Injection (CVSS 9.8)

Tozed ZLT X300 5G CPE firmware 6.01.3 has an unauthenticated TR-069 command injection (CVE-2026-2035703, CVSS 9.8) enabling root code execution.

Tozed ZLT X300 5G CPE router firmware 6.01.3 contains an OS command injection (CWE-78) in the TR-069/CWMP client daemon netcwmpd, tracked as CVE-2026-2035703 with CVSS 9.8. The IPPingDiagnostics Host parameter is passed unsanitized into sprintf, and the resulting shell command executes via system_by_root() as root. An attacker operating a rogue LTE base station built from roughly $300 of SDR hardware can impersonate the carrier's Auto Configuration Server and inject arbitrary commands. The disclosure does not report any observed exploitation.

Payara 7.2026.1.RC1 Remote Code Execution via Server-Side Includes #exec Directive in Payara Server

Payara Server 7.2026.1.RC1 executes arbitrary OS commands when user-controlled Server-Side Includes #exec directives are passed to Runtime.exec without validation.

Payara Server contains a vulnerability in its Server-Side Includes (SSI) implementation that permits arbitrary operating system command execution via the #exec directive. User-controlled SSI directives are passed directly to Runtime.exec() without validation, sanitization, or restriction. An attacker who can cause the server to process an SSI file such as .shtml can execute arbitrary OS commands. The disclosed affected version is 7.2026.1.RC1.
